Workshop Details After successfully completing Safe Zone I and Safe Zone II workshops, participants are considered an Advocate and provided with a plaque. The title of Advocate indicates acceptance of LGBTQIA+ identities and a commitment to working against discrimination directed toward the community. A hold is a notation applied to a student's record that prevents certain actions, such as registration. A student with a hold must satisfy the requirements of that hold before the restriction may be lifted.
